Load testing is a type of software performance testing that verifies the stability and scalability of a software utility by subjecting it to a set amount of anticipated usage.

load testing definition

Load testing focuses on verifying an application’s performance underneath anticipated or normal load. Stress testing, then again, is meant to check its upper load restrict or breaking point. Nonetheless, handbook load testing just isn’t the most efficient method when testing for top load eventualities. For occasion, testing an application’s response to 10 customers can feasibly be accomplished manually, but when the load will increase to 1500 users, automation testing turns into necessary. Automated load testing replaces manual users with an automation tool that mimics real-time person actions, significantly saving sources and time​. An API (Application Programming Interface) is a algorithm and protocols that allow completely different software program purposes to speak with one another. It serves as a bridge between two different functions, enabling them to trade knowledge and carry out tasks seamlessly. Automated knowledge integration involves integrating databases, information warehouses, or knowledge lakes to automate knowledge switch and synchronization across completely different techniques. It can even embrace modifying data from one format to a different or accessing it from a unified UI. For instance, you’ll be able to connect an e-commerce application and delivery software program to exchange data automatically with a listing management solution.

A facilitator, by definition, is somebody who makes an action or course of easier or extra achievable, guiding teams and people towards the accomplishment of their aims. Whereas the perform of the Agile team facilitator sounds a lot like that of a Scrum Master, there are a couple of significant variations. Agile facilitators work with several teams, whereas Scrum Masters only work with one team. An Agile facilitator might help resolve points that affect productiveness and improve the staff’s capacity to function as a unit.
